Leading the Charge: Our Bureaucratic Trailblazers

The civil services continue to be a beacon of change. We see officers like IAS Ankur Garg, who, after excelling in the UPSC exams and pursuing global education, is now pivotal in Union Territory governance. His journey is a testament to the blend of sharp intellect and hands-on administrative skills. Equally inspiring is Priya Agrawal, who achieved her dream of becoming a Deputy Collector after multiple attempts, reminding us that perseverance truly pays off. In innovative governance, IAS Dr. Aruna Sharma spearheaded the digitization of Panchayats, aligning grassroots administration with global sustainability goals. On the law and order front, IPS officers like Noorul Hasan in Bhandara and Harvinder Singh in Bokaro are launching impactful initiatives, from free coaching for civil services aspirants to enhancing night safety through rapid response teams. These stories highlight the human touch and commitment our officers bring to public service.

Economic Momentum and Strategic Partnerships

India’s economic landscape is buzzing with activity. Public Sector Undertakings (PSUs) are playing a crucial role in this growth story. We see significant collaborations, such as the Rail Vikas Nigam Limited (RVNL) joining hands with Texmaco Rail & Engineering to bolster India’s rail manufacturing capacity and expand global projects. Bharat Electronics Limited (BEL) showcases robust financial health with strong credit ratings, while NTPC Limited is recognized for its excellence in human capital development. These developments, along with NTPC Renewable Energy commencing commercial operations for its Khavda-II Solar Project, underline India’s march towards industrial strength and a greener future. Even in sports, Public-Private Partnerships are taking shape, like the new international cricket stadium in Gorakhpur, backed by Indian Oil, promising both infrastructure development and economic benefits.

Justice and Fair Play

Our judiciary remains a cornerstone of fairness. Recent rulings by the Delhi High Court provide much-needed clarity on age relaxation for ex-servicemen in unreserved job categories, ensuring equitable opportunities. The Supreme Court is gearing up for crucial hearings on the Citizenship Amendment Act (CAA) and a challenge against the three-year practice rule for law graduates seeking judicial service, demonstrating its commitment to constitutional principles and legal reforms. The Calcutta High Court has also delivered a significant verdict by prohibiting mid-process changes to cut-off marks in recruitment, providing relief and certainty to government job aspirants.
